But integer ranges? I guess they would be useful to catch array indexing mistakes,

I'm not sure they would. For an index error to be caught at compile
time, the thing being indexed has to have a size known to the
compiler. This was always the case in Pascal, and sometimes is in
C/C++/C#/Java, but almost never is in Python.
